These listings serve as public records of individuals’ passing, traditionally provided by funeral homes. They commonly include biographical information, details regarding funeral services, and expressions of sympathy or remembrance. As an example, a notice might contain the full name of the deceased, their date of birth, a summary of their life, and specifics about the memorial service location and time.
Access to these announcements offers several benefits. They allow community members to stay informed about the passing of acquaintances, friends, or family. They also provide a centralized location for sharing condolences and paying respects. Historically, these announcements were primarily disseminated through print media, but now are increasingly accessible online, broadening their reach and facilitating wider community awareness.
